15-minute maximum stay rule removed
Restrictions on visiting at Noble's Hospital have been eased.
Manx Care says anyone attending to see a patient can now stay longer than 15 minutes.
However only one visitor is allowed around a bed at any one time.
Visitors must also still wear a face covering and sanitise their hands, when entering and leaving, the hospital.
Registration forms also need to be completed before entering any hospital ward.
Anyone who has tested positive for Covid-19, or who is showing symptoms, won't be allowed to enter the building.
